Mr. Thompson “Tommy” Gregory Little, Jr., age 81, of Moncure, N.C., died Thursday, June 13, 2013, at Central Carolina Hospital. He was born in Lee County on January 10, 1932, to the late Thompson & Evelyn Little. In addition to his parents he was also preceded in death by a brother Harold Little and a very special aunt, Estelle Powers. Mr. Little served our country in the United States Navy; was the first motorcycle policeman on the Sanford Police Department; was a member and Past Master of Sanford Masonic Lodge #151; and was the former owner and operator of Little’s Super Shell before his career in trucking. He was a jack-of-all-trades and could do almost anything.
